4. How to Qualify for a Certified Home Loan
To qualify for a certified home loan, you will need organize your financial records. Your lender will require proof of earnings and past credit, as well as details on your debts.

This is followed by a pre-approval stage, where the lender assesses your financial profile and borrowing range. It clarifies how much you can spend, narrowing down homes within your range.

Finally, you work with your lender to complete the paperwork, ensuring the process is smooth.
